BATTERY CHARGING
New2001
Charging
Prior to using the receiver for the first time, the battery pack
must be fully charged for optimum life and operation.

D Charging note
• Be sure to turn the receiver power OFF.
Otherwise the battery pack will not be charged completely or takes
longer to charge time periods.
External DC power operation becomes possible when
using an optional CP-18A/E. The attached battery pack is
also charged simultaneously.
If your battery pack seems to have no capacity even after
being charged, fully charge the battery pack again. If the
battery pack still does not retain a charge (or very little), a
new battery pack must be purchased.
q
Insert the battery pack (BP-244) into the receiver. (p. 2)
w Plug the battery charger (BC-149A/D*) into an AC outlet;
or the optional CP-18A/E into a cigarette lighter socket.
* Not supplied with some versions.
e Turn OFF the receiver, then insert the adapter plug into
[DC 6V] of the receiver.
CAUTION: BE SURE to disconnect the CP-18A/E from
the cigarette lighter socket when charging is finished. A
slight current drain from the CP-18A/E will eventually
drain the vehicle’s battery.
